Output 626037fab0e7bd474dde0a206a55132d4b0a6994ed6efe97bcd4a9d153aba1d6:0

value
2638760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c845f0ced0969d46b335851e4d782e1ee36e812 OP_EQUALVERIFY OP_CHECKSIG
address
154PJm2XosdgttmnxWFg6dh65AN76Y6zmA
transaction
626037fab0e7bd474dde0a206a55132d4b0a6994ed6efe97bcd4a9d153aba1d6
confirmations
326919
spent
true